Diagnosis (adult female and male).
Epistome with smooth antero-lateral projections, widest at the base; setae
j1
,
z2-z6
,
s5
,
r3
,
r6
,
J2-J5
,
Z1-Z5
,
S2-S5
pilose in distal half; other dorsal idiosomal setae smooth; podonotal shield with four small circular scleronoduli between setae
j5
and
j6
; peritrematal shield broad and long, extending anteriorly onto the dorsum but not fused to podonotal shield; pretarsus I, a single, sessile, curved claw. Adult female with podonotal shield mostly with series of short, wavy lines mostly aligned transversely or diagonally; opisthonotal shield imbricate with many imbrications containing series of short longitudinal lines; sternal shield lightly reticulate; unsclerotised integument between genital and ventrianal shields with three transverse elongate accessory platelets; ventrianal shield with six pairs of setae (
Jv2-Jv5
,
Zv2
and
Zv3
) in addition to circum-anal setae. Adult male with podonotal shield imbricate; opisthonotal shield imbricate with imbrications without series of short, longitudinal lines; sternogenital shield lightly reticulate; unsclerotised integument between sternogenital and ventrianal shields with an ellipsoidal accessory platelet; ventrianal shield with 12 pairs of setae (
R1-R4
,
Jv1-Jv5
and
Zv1- Zv3
) in addition to circum-anal setae; seta
r4
on peritrematal shield.

Remarks.
This species was described on the basis of the adult female
holotype
, one adult female
paratype
and two adult male
paratypes
. The following characteristics appear in the original description and illustrations of the species, but do not agree with our observations of the female
holotype
: margin of epistome smooth between anteromedial and antero-lateral projections; setae
j1
,
j6
,
z4-z6
,
s4-s5
,
r3
,
r5-r6
,
J1-J5
,
Z2-Z5
,
S1-S5
and
Jv5
totally pilose, other setae smooth; genital shield smooth; peritrematal shield ornamented; lyrifissures present only on podonotal shield (one pair) and sternal shield (three pairs). No information was provided about the chelicera, hypostome, tritosternum and leg setal counts. The measurements provided in the original description referred to the length of the idiosoma (320–400), width of idiosoma (200–250), length of setae
j1
(cited as
i1
) (20),
j4
(cited as
i3
) (20),
j5
(cited as
i4
) (20),
r3
(cited as
r5
) (35),
J1
(cited as
I1
) (17),
J3
(cited as
I3
) (25),
J4
(cited as
I4
) (25),
Z3
(25),
Z4
(30),
Z5
(30),
S4
(27),
S5
(32),
Jv5
(cited as
V8
) (30) and length of other ventral idiosomal setae (25).
For the adult male
paratypes
, the only characteristics provided referred to details of the spermatodactyl and ventral setae of femur, genu and tibia II, as well as measurements for length (380) and width (230) of the idiosoma.
